The law firm you choose must have comprehensive knowledge of both New York and Federal trucking laws. This is because accidents involving 18 wheelers (semi-trucks) can have several liable parties.

For example, truck drivers are obligated to abide by federal regulations regarding fatigue. If these regulations are violated and the truck driver is tired while driving and falls asleep, they could be held accountable for the accident.

Expertise

If you are injured in the course of a truck crash that is caused by a truck driver, both the driver and the trucking company could be held accountable. A knowledgeable attorney for 18 wheelers will investigate your accident to determine if the driver has violated traffic laws and caused your injuries. They may also discover manufacturing defects that could have caused the accident.

A large truck weighs 30 times more than a standard passenger car and, as such, any collision between the truck and a passenger vehicle could result in devastating injuries and even damage. Due to this, commercial trucks are subject to more stringent laws than passenger vehicles. An experienced attorney will be able to examine all relevant traffic laws and regulations to ensure the trucker was not breaking any of them.

Large trucks require a great deal of systematic maintenance to function correctly. Inability to carry out regular inspections and keep detailed records could result in problems such as brake failure or a tire blowout. An experienced lawyer can look through the trucking company’s maintenance records to ensure that the truck was in compliance with certain standards before a crash occurred.

The 18-wheeler is more hazardous due to its size and weight. They have large blind zones and can cause catastrophic injury when they collide with smaller vehicles. Many of these accidents occur because trucking companies or drivers have not adhered to basic safety procedures.

Commercial trucks are subject to strict Federal regulations that regulate the amount of time they are allowed to stay on the road prior to taking breaks and what food they can consume while driving. They also have limitations on how much cargo can be transported. They also have to undergo regular inspections and maintenance. Their braking systems, as well as other components are monitored using log books as well as devices called “black boxes” which record data on the performance of the vehicle.
